Transaction 74c1cf3d95290317bb99a1ef1ce1315ea00802d5ef180cf3c80c00a86578cfaa
1 Input
2 Outputs
- 74c1cf3d95290317bb99a1ef1ce1315ea00802d5ef180cf3c80c00a86578cfaa:0
- 74c1cf3d95290317bb99a1ef1ce1315ea00802d5ef180cf3c80c00a86578cfaa:1
value 140277544
address 15uMZ2EqCrCubWsnh3HQaFGsLhExYqKRfR
value 3782698
address 1G7dqMvf2Y1kek8P89duPH9tePmLrP8ALU